Conquering the Art of Selling Your House in Today's Market
In today's dynamic real estate landscape, successfully selling your house requires a strategic plan. First and foremost, it's crucial to understand the current market trends. Research comparable home sales in your area to gauge a realistic listing price.
Next, consider enhancing your property to make a lasting first appearance on potential buyers. Declutter, depersonalize, and highlight your home's best features. High-quality photographs and a compelling property overview are also essential for attracting online viewers.
Collaborating with an experienced real estate agent can provide invaluable support throughout the selling process. They can help you navigate offers, market your property effectively, and facilitate a smooth transaction.
Remember, patience and determination are key in today's market. Be prepared to refine your strategy as needed and remain confident about finding the right buyer for your home.

Embark on Journey from Listing to Closing: A Comprehensive Guide to Selling Your Property
Selling your property can be a multifaceted process that demands careful planning and execution. From the initial listing stage to the final closing, navigating each step effectively is crucial for a smooth sale. This comprehensive guide shall illuminate the key stages involved in selling your property, providing valuable insights and strategies along the way.
First and foremost, ready your property for listing by making necessary repairs. A well-maintained and appealing property will attract interested parties. Once you've prepared, it's time to list your property with a qualified real estate agent who can effectively market your home amongst the target pool.
Next, be prepared for showings and open houses. Create a welcoming atmosphere that highlights the best features of your property. During showings, it's important to be present and address any questions potential buyers may have. Discussions offers is the next stage, where you will work with your real estate agent to determine the best offer for you.
Finally, the closing process involves finalizing all legal requirements. This includes a thorough review of all documents, assigning ownership, and settling any remaining fees.
During this entire process, it's crucial to remain organized, informed, and proactive. By following these steps and seeking professional guidance when needed, you can navigate the complexities of selling your property with confidence.
Mastering the Home Buying Process: Step-by-Step Strategies for Success
Purchasing a home represents a significant milestone in life, but the process can seem overwhelming. Thankfully, with a well-structured approach and strategic planning, you can efficiently navigate this journey and achieve your dream of homeownership.
First, diligently assess your financial situation by analyzing your budget, credit score, and debt-to-income ratio. This essential step will assist you in understanding your buying power and setting realistic expectations. Next, collaborate with a reputable real estate agent who can provide valuable market insights and guide you through the complexities of the search process.
- Initiate your home search by exploring listings that match with your needs and budget.
- Book viewings for properties that capture your attention and meticulously inspect each one.
- After you find the perfect home, submit a competitive offer.
Be prepared to negotiate with the seller and their representative until you reach mutually agreeable terms. Across this process, maintain open communication with your real estate agent, lender, and other relevant parties.
